Keratin 7 (Krt7) is a member of the keratin family and is primarily involved in cytoskeleton composition. It has been shown that Krt7 is able to influence its own remodeling and interactions with other signaling molecules via phosphorylation at specific sites unique to Krt7. However, its molecular mechanism in acute lung injury (ALI) remains unclear. In this study, differential proteomics was used to analyze lung samples from the receptor for advanced glycation end products (RAGE)-deficient and (wild-type)WT-septic mice. We screened for the target protein Krt7 and identified Ser53 as the phosphorylation site using mass spectrometry (MS), and this phosphorylation further triggered the deformation and disintegration of Desmoplakin (Dsp), ultimately leading to epithelial barrier dysfunction. Furthermore, we demonstrated that in sepsis, mDia1/Cdc42/p38 MAPK signaling activation plays a role in septic lung injury. We also explored the mechanism of alveolar dysfunction of the Krt7-Dsp complex in the epithelial cell barrier. In summary, the present findings increase our understanding of the pathogenesis of septic acute lung injury.

The genomic landscape and driver-gene mutations differ significantly among diverse histological subtypes of clear cell renal cell carcinoma (ccRCC) due to the intratumoral heterogeneity. Frequent mutations in canonical DNA damage response genes, such as BRCA1/2 or ATR serine/threonine kinase (ATR) haven't been reported even in large-scale genomic profiling of ccRCC researches. Herein, we reported a rare ccRCC harboring ATR and BRCA2 simultaneous mutation with complicated morphologies and extensive metastases. Our case indicates that the deleterious alteration of DNA damage response genes, increasing CD8+ TILs, high PD1/PD-L1 expression and high TMB might contribute to this patient's tumor metastasis and aggressive biological behavior.

OBJECTIVE: To observe the effect of moxibustion on mRNA expression of signal transducers and activators of transcription 1 (STAT 1), suppressors of cytokine signaling (SOCS) in synovium of rheumatoid arthritis (RA) rats, and to investigate its mechanism for relieving RA. METHODS: 40 Wistar rats were equally and randomly divided into control, model, moxibustion, acupuncture and infrared groups (n = 8 in each group). RA model was developed by putting rats in windy, cold and damp room and injection of Freund's complete adjuvant. Bilateral "Shenshu" (BL 23) were stimulated by the respective means for 20 min in duration, once every other day, ten times in total. The swelling degree of voix pedis (perimeter) of rats was measured. The contents of serum interleukin-1 (IL-1) and interleukin-2(IL-2) were detected by radioimmunoassay, and expression of STAT 1, SOCS mRNA in synovium were assessed by RT-PCR. RESULTS: Rats in model group had acute and severe swelling of voix pedis, together with the increase of serum IL-1 content and decrease of IL-2 content, and down-regulation of mRNA expression of both STAT 1 and SOCS in synovium(all P<0. 01). All three modalities of treatment alleviated the swelling and reversed the relevant changes(P<0. 05, P<0. 01) , however, moxibustion produced greater effects than acupuncture or infrared in elevating IL-2 content and up-regulating mRNA expression of both STAT 1 and SOCS. CONCLUSION: Moxibustion achieves the effects of anti-inflammation and joint swelling reduction of RA via decrease of IL-1, increase of IL-2 in serum and up-regulation of STAT 1, SOCS mRNA expression in synovium.

OBJECTIVE: To observe the effect of moxibustion intervention on the expression of toll-like receptor-4 (TLR 4), myeloid differentiation factor 88(MyD 88), and nuclear factor kappa B p 65 (NF-κB p 65) genes of knee-joint synovial cells in rheumatoid arthritis (RA) rats, so as to explore its molecular mechanism underlying improving RA. METHODS: Forty SD rats were randomly divided into normal control, RA model, moxibustion and medication groups (n = 10). The RA model was duplicated by raising the rats in a windy, cold and wet environment, followed by injecting Freund's complete adjuvant (0. 15 mL) into the rat's foot. Moxibustion was applied to "Shenshu" (BL 23) and "Zusanli" (ST 36) for 20 min, once daily for 15 days. Rats of the medication group were treated by intragastric administration of tripterygium wilfordii (8. 75 mL/kg), once daily for 15 days. Pathological changes of the synovial tissues were detected by H. E. stain, the contents of serum TNF-α and IL-1 detected by radioimmunoassay, and the expression levels of TLR 4 mRNA, MyD 88 mRNA and TRAF-6 mRNA of synovial tissue were analyzed by real time-PCR, and the NF-κB p 65 immunoactivity was assayed by immunohistochemistry. RESULTS: In comparison with the normal control group, the synovial tissue of the knee-joint was impaired remarkably and infiltrated by numerous inflammatory cells, and the synovial surface got thickening because of hyperplasia in the model group. Following moxibustion and medication, these situations such as synovial infiltration of inflammatory, synovial cell proliferation were alleviated. The serum TNF-α and IL-1 contents and synovial TLR 4 mRNA, MyD 88 mRNA, TRAF-6 mRNA and NF-κB p 65 expression levels were remarkably higher in the model group than in the control group(P<0. 01). After moxibustion and medication, the contents of serum TNF-α and IL-1, the expression levels of TLR 4 mRNA, MyD 88 mRNA, TRAF-6 mRNA and NF-κB p 65 were significantly down-regulated(P<0. 01, P<0. 05). CONCLUSION: Moxibustion intervention can improve pathological changes of the knee-joint synovial membrane tissue in RA rats, which may be related with its effect in inhibiting abnormal activation of TLR 4-MyD 88-NF-κB pathway in synovial tissue.

OBJECTIVE: To observe the influence of moxibustion of "Shenshu"(BL 23) and "Zusanli" (ST 36) on the microstructure of synovial cells in the knee-joint in rheumatoidarthritis (RA) rats so as to study its underlying mechanism in anti-inflammatory immune effect. METHODS: A total of 120 Wistar rats were randomized into normal control, model, acupuncture, moxibustion, CO2-laser and medication groups (n = 20/group). RA model was duplicated by raising the rats in a windy (electro-fan blowing), cold [(6 +/- 2) degrees] and wet (80%-90%) environment for 12 h/d and 20 days, followed by injecting Freund's complete adjuvant (0.15 mL) into the rat's ankle. Moxibustion or acupuncture or CO2 laser (10.6 microm) irradiation was applied to "Shenshu" (BL 23) and "Zusanli" (ST 36) for 20 min, once daily for 15 days. Intragastric perfusion of Leigongteng (Tripterygium Wilfordii Hook.f.) was given to medication group, 8 mg/kg, once daily for 15 days. The thoracic gland index [weight of the thoracic gland (mg)/ body weight (g) x 100%] and spleen index [weight of the spleen (mg)/body weight (g) x 100%] were calculated after killing the rats under anesthesia. The ultrastructure of synovial cells of the knee-joint was observed by using transmission electron microscopy. RESULTS: In comparison with the normal control group, the thoracic gland index in the model group was decreased significantly (P < 0.01), while the spleen index of the model group increased considerably (P < 0.05). In comparison with the model group, the thoracic gland indexes in the acupuncture, moxibustion, CO-laser and medication groups were increased significantly (P < 0.05, P < 0.01), whereas the spleen indexes in the four groups decreased evidently (P < 0.05). No significant differences were found among the acupuncture, moxibustion, CO2-laser and medication groups in up-regulating the thoracic gland index and down-regulating the spleen index (P > 0.05). After modeling, the synoviocytes of the knee-joint were impaired remarkably, exhibiting incomplete cellular membrane, some prolapsed organelles, marginalized stained granules in the cellular nucleus, vague nuclear membrane, enlarged rough endoplasmic reticulum, reduction in the number of mitochondria with vacuolization degeneration and multiple lysosomes. But, the pathological changes of the ultrastructure of most synoviocytes in the acupuncture, moxibustion, CO2-laser and medication groups were relatively milder. CONCLUSION: Moxibustion can protect the immune organs (thoracic gland and spleen) from injury and improve pathological changes of the ultrastructure of local synoviocytes in RA rats.
